About 1-amino-N-(oxetan-3-yl)cyclobutane-1-carboxamide
1-amino-N-(oxetan-3-yl)cyclobutane-1-carboxamide (PubChem CID 81168637) has the molecular formula C8H14N2O2
and a molecular weight of 170.21 g/mol. Its IUPAC name is 1-amino-N-(oxetan-3-yl)cyclobutane-1-carboxamide.
